Olney's game last Wednesday was a loss, but they didn't let that memory haunt them on Monday. They came out on top against the Saul Razorbacks by a score of 3-1.
Olney had a slow start but a hot finish: after dropping the first set, they turned around to win the next three. The final score came out to 18-25, 25-22, 25-20, 25-14.
Olney's victory bumped their record up to 5-3. As for Saul, their defeat was their third straight on the road, which dropped their record down to 3-5.
We've got plenty of inter-conference action coming up soon. Olney will face off against rival Kensington at 3:15 p.m. on Thursday. Meanwhile, Saul is set to take on their familiar foe Mastery Charter South co-op [Mastery Charter Lenfest/Mastery Charter Thomas] at 3:15 p.m. on Thursday.
